Abstract

Meta-analysis is a subset of systematic review; a technique for systematically combining pertinent qualitative
and quantitative study data from numerous selected studies to broaden a single conclusion that has more
statistical power. This inference is statistically stronger than the analysis of any single study, due to increase
numbers of topics, greater variety amongst subjects, or collected effects and outcomes. The aim of this review
article is to highlight the definition, history, purpose, characteristics, use, advantage, disadvantage, validity,
and steps in conducting meta-analysis.
